Lancaster University is a leading global research institution, rooted in its local community. Modern and forward-thinking, the University consistently ranks among the top dozen UK universities, the top 150 globally, and is among the best on any objective measure. Our ambition is to be sustainable, academically excellent and recognised as one of the leading universities in the world. With a turnover of c.£400m, 3,350 staff, and more than 27,000 students (of which c.11,600 are studying through our international campus partnerships), we excel in innovative research, education, and engagement, as evidenced by our research ranking 21st in REF 2021, our strong KEF performance, our TEF Gold rating, and strong NSS performance. Our collegiate system supports a diverse community, nurturing talents and personal growth, and our campuses in Lancaster and around the world attract brilliant minds who drive economic, cultural, societal, and environmental change. Committed to civic engagement, we make a positive impact locally, nationally and globally. Supporting over 8,800 jobs and contributing an estimated £2bn to the UK economy, we attract investment for regional, social, economic and environmental benefit, through initiatives such as the Health Innovation Campus and the Eden Project Morecambe.
To build on this strong foundation and to drive further success, we are seeking to appoint a new Registrar, Secretary and Chief Operating Officer (RSCOO). As a key member of the University’s Executive Board (UEB), reporting directly to the Vice-Chancellor, the RSCOO will play a critical role in the development and execution of strategic plans which assure the sustainable future success of the University. They will be responsible for managing and ensuring our professional services drive organisational progress and effectively support and enhance our academic ambitions. As Secretary to Council, the RSCOO will have responsibility for our institutional governance and regulatory requirements and will act as a trusted advisor to the Vice-Chancellor and the Chair of Council, playing a pivotal role in the relationship between the Council and the University Executive Board.
We are seeking a strategic leader with a proven ability to build, lead and inspire high-performing teams with responsibility for wide-ranging services. They will have a strong track record of delivering high-quality, integrated services that help drive business performance, combined with the ability to drive change at pace in a complex regulatory environment. With excellent judgement, communication skills, and high levels of emotional intelligence, they will be comfortable advising boards and stimulating and challenging thinking. Commercial acuity, strong analytical skills, and the ability to cultivate highly productive relationships with a diverse range of stakeholders will also be essential.
